What is Christmastide and how long does it last?

Christmastide is the period of time beginning on Christmas Day and lasting until the Feast of the Epiphany on January 6th. It is a season of celebration in the Christian calendar that focuses on the birth of Jesus Christ and the events surrounding his early life.

What are Methodist holidays?

Main Holidays include Easter, Christmas, and All Saints Day. Methodists also observe holy seasons such as; Advent, Christmastide, Lent, and Pentecost.
